Brisk Walking Boosts Verbal Creativity, Study Finds

Emerging research underscores the profound connection between physical activity and cognitive function, particularly highlighting how a moderate intensity walk can significantly amplify verbal creativity. This groundbreaking study, detailed in the prestigious journal 'Sport, Exercise, and Performance Psychology,' meticulously tracked the daily routines of individuals, revealing a specific window of opportunity where a brisk stroll can catalyze imaginative thought processes approximately an hour later. The findings not only reinforce the long-held belief in the benefits of exercise for mental well-being but also pinpoint crucial parameters for optimizing creative output.
The Intricate Dance Between Movement and Imagination
In a compelling investigation into the dynamics of human creativity, researchers led by Christian Rominger from the University of Graz, Austria, embarked on an ambitious journey to unravel the precise relationship between physical exertion and the generation of novel ideas. Recognizing the inherent challenges of simulating real-world scenarios in a lab, the team adopted an innovative 'bottom-up' observational approach. For five days, 157 young adults were equipped with sophisticated chest sensors that meticulously recorded their physical movements, capturing data on acceleration and altitude 64 times per second. Simultaneously, a custom-designed smartphone application periodically prompted participants to engage in short cognitive tasks, testing both verbal and figural creativity. Participants were given a mere 60 seconds to articulate a unique idea or craft a digital drawing, providing a rich dataset for analysis. Independent assessors then evaluated the originality of these submissions, ensuring a robust measure of creative novelty.
The collected data, segmented into one-minute intervals, allowed for an unprecedented analysis of movement patterns preceding each creative prompt. The researchers categorized physical activity using metabolic equivalents, ranging from sedentary behavior to light, moderate, and vigorous activities. This comprehensive approach unveiled a striking revelation: a 10 to 25-minute period of moderate physical activity, such as a brisk walk, consistently predicted a notable increase in verbal creativity. This creative surge was most pronounced when the exercise session concluded approximately 60 to 70 minutes before the cognitive task, suggesting an optimal recovery window that primes the brain for imaginative thinking. Interestingly, light intensity activity was found to have a detrimental effect on verbal creativity, while vigorous exercise and sedentary behavior showed no significant correlation. Figural creativity, on the other hand, did not exhibit similar associations, implying distinct neural pathways for different forms of creative expression.
To bolster the validity of their initial findings, the research team conducted a follow-up study with 76 new participants, employing Bayesian statistical methods to integrate the previous data and strengthen the reliability of their observations. The replication study reaffirmed the strong positive link between moderate exercise and delayed verbal creativity, as well as the negative impact of light physical activity. These consistent results underscore the potential for precisely tailored exercise routines to enhance cognitive flexibility. While acknowledging the observational nature of their study and the need for further randomized controlled trials across diverse populations, the researchers emphasized that these insights lay a critical foundation for developing evidence-based recommendations for cognitive health and creative enhancement.
